In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ding S43 1HY has a slightly higher male population, with 51.8%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Female | 48.6% | 48.2% | -0.4% | 51.0% | -2.8% |
| Male | 51.4% | 51.8% | 0.4% | 49.0% | 2.8% |

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.
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.
This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(87.6%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Very good health | 42% | 47.7% | 5.7% | 48.4% | -0.7% |
| Good health | 41.2% | 39.9% | -1.3% | 33.6% | 6.3% |
| Fair health | 13.1% | 7.5% | -5.6% | 12.7% | -5.2% |
| Bad health | 3.3% | 3.6% | 0.3% | 4.0% | -0.4% |
| Very bad health | 0.4% | 1.3% | 0.9% | 1.2% | 0.1% |

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Victoria Street was 72.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 9.9% lower than the Brimington North average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.
Victoria Street has the 34th lowest crime rate of 75 local areas in Brimington North and the 166th lowest crime rate of 357 local areas in Chesterfield .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 13.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-39.3%.
